Daily Inspiration Quote by Morgan Freeman

"People hear that and say I'm being modest, but I am not a modest person, but I have to be truthful about what I'm doing and what I'm doing is channeling"

About this Quote

Freeman is doing something sneaky here: rejecting the feel-good narrative that great performers are “humbled” by their talent, while still dodging the ego trap that comes with claiming authorship over magic. The line pivots on a blunt confession - “I am not a modest person” - which lands like a preemptive strike against celebrity PR. He won’t let the audience rescue him with a flattering misread. He names vanity as a fact, not a sin, and that candor is its own kind of authority.

Then he reroutes the conversation to craft. “I have to be truthful about what I’m doing” frames acting as an ethical obligation: accuracy over self-mythology. The crucial word is “channeling,” a term that borrows from the mystical without fully committing to it. He’s describing the actor’s best illusion: when performance feels less like fabrication and more like reception. In that framing, Freeman isn’t the genius-god delivering brilliance; he’s the antenna, tuned and disciplined enough to let something else come through - character, text, director, cultural archetype, whatever you want to call it.

The subtext is also defensive in a smart way. Channeling lets him claim intensity without claiming credit, vulnerability without false humility. For an actor whose voice and presence have been treated as near-oracular by pop culture, it’s a corrective: the “Freeman-ness” people project onto him isn’t a divine gift, it’s a practiced conduit. The performance isn’t modest. The explanation is honest.
